About the Creative Team

Nan Barber (copy editor, first edition) co-authored Office X for the Macintosh: The Missing Manual and Office 2001 for Macintosh: The Missing Manual. As the principal copy editor for this series, she has edited the titles on Mac OS X, Dreamweaver, Windows XP Home Edition, and others. Email: .

John Cacciatore (copy editor, this edition) is a freelance writer, editor, and proofreader. For the past 10 years, he has tangled with semi-colons, dashes, and ellipses from his suburban Massachusetts home. Naturally, this means he’s also a Red Sox lifer. Email: .

Rose Cassano (cover illustration) has worked as an independent designer and illustrator for 20 years. Assignments have spanned everything from the nonprofit sector to corporate clientele. She lives in beautiful Southern Oregon, grateful for the miracles of modern technology that make living and working there a reality. Email: . Web: http://www.rosecassano.com.

David A. Karp (technical editor, this edition) is the author of nine power-user books, including the bestselling Windows XP Annoyances for Geeks (Second Edition) and eBay Hacks: 100 Industrial-Strength Tips & Tools. You can sometimes find his articles in PC Magazine and ZTrack Magazine, or on Annoyances.org. When he’s not inserting arcane pop culture references into his writing, he spends his time as a cyclist, activist, pessimist, optimist, photographer, and moviegoer.
